Pumpkin Spice Latte Cupcake Ingredients

For the Cupcakes
2 cups all-purpose flour – this provides the perfect structure for your cupcakes.
1½ cups granulated sugar – adds the sweetness that balances the spices beautifully.
2 teaspoons baking powder – ensures your cupcakes rise to fluffy perfection.
1 teaspoon baking soda – gives an extra lift to your delightful treats.
½ teaspoon salt – enhances the overall flavor, making it more pronounced.
1½ teaspoons ground cinnamon – the quintessential spice that brings warmth and nostalgia.
1 teaspoon pumpkin pie spice – infuses those classic autumn flavors into every bite.
3 large eggs – binds everything together while keeping the cupcakes moist.
15 oz. canned pumpkin puree – the star ingredient that delivers that rich, pumpkin flavor.
¼ cup coffee – adds a subtle depth, echoing the beloved pumpkin spice latte.
1 tablespoon instant coffee – intensifies the coffee flavor without the fuss.
¼ cup half and half or full-fat milk/cream – ensures a tender crumb and richness.
½ cup vegetable oil – keeps your cupcakes moist and deliciously tender.

For the Frosting
6 oz. cream cheese – the creamy base that lends a tangy sweetness to your frosting.
9 tablespoons butter – gives the frosting a rich texture that’s hard to resist.
½ cup shortening – helps stabilize the frosting for beautiful décor.
1½ teaspoons pumpkin pie spice – carries the seasonal flavor through to the frosting as well.
2½ cups powdered confectioners’ sugar – sweetens and thickens the frosting to perfection.

How to Make Pumpkin Spice Latte Cupcakes

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Prepare cupcake liners in a muffin tin for easy serving. Your kitchen will begin to fill with the comforting scent of warmth and spice!

  2. Whisk together the all-purpose fl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t, ground cinnamon, and pumpkin pie spice in a large bowl. This mix will ensure your cupcakes are fluffy and full of flavor.

  3. Combine the wet ingredients in another bowl: whisk the eggs, pumpkin puree, coffee, instant coffee, half and half (or milk/cream), and vegetable oil until smooth. This step brings that rich, cozy essence of a pumpkin spice latte into your batter.

  4. Mix the dry ingredients into the wet mixture gradually. Stir until just combined, being careful not to over-mix; you want fluffy cupcakes that will rise perfectly!

  5. Pour the batter evenly into your prepared cupcake liners. Fill each liner about two-thirds full to allow room for rising.

  6. Bake for 18-20 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ean. The tops should be lightly golden and puffed up with joy!

  7. Prepare the frosting while the cupcakes cool. In a bowl, beat together the cream cheese, butter, shortening, pumpkin pie spice, and powdered sugar until smooth and creamy. This frosting will delight your taste buds with every bite!

  8. Cool the cupcakes completely before frosting them to avoid melting. A frosted cupcake is a masterpiece, and we want yours to be just right!

  9. Decorate with crushed gingersnap cookies, add a whimsical touch with green straws, and drizzle with caramel sauce as desired. These finishing touches will make them irresistible!

Optional: Top with extra gingersnap cookie crumbs for added crunch!

How to Store and Freeze Pumpkin Spice Latte Cupcakes

Room Temperature: Store unfrosted cupcakes in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 2 days to maintain their moisture and flavor.

Fridge: If frosted, keep your cupcakes in the refrigerator for up to 5 days. Place them in a covered cake stand or a sealed container to prevent drying out.

Freezer: For longer storage, freeze unfrosted cupcakes by wrapping them individually in plastic wrap and placing them in a freezer-safe bag for up to 3 months.

Reheating: To enjoy your frozen cupcakes, simply thaw them in the refrigerator overnight. You can gently warm them in the microwave for about 10-15 seconds if you prefer them warm, then frost with your favorite cream cheese topping!

Make Ahead Options

These Pumpkin Spice Latte Cupcakes are perfect for busy home cooks looking to save time! You can prepare the batter up to 24 hours in advance by mixing the dry and wet ingredients separately, then refrigerating them until you’re ready to bake. The cupcakes themselves can also be baked up to 3 days ahead and stored in an airtight container at room temperature. For the frosting, whip it up and refrigerate it for up to 3 days; just make sure to give it a quick stir before using. When you’re ready to serve, simply frost the cooled cupcakes and add your favorite decorations—these cupcakes will be just as delicious as if made fresh that day!

Tips for the Best Pumpkin Spice Latte Cupcakes

Perfectly Moist: Use room temperature ingredients, especially eggs and pumpkin puree, to ensure a smoother batter and tender cupcakes.

Don’t Overmix: Gently fold the dry ingredients into the wet mixture. Overmixing can lead to dense cupcakes; we want them light and fluffy!

Cool Completely: Allow the cupcakes to cool fully before frosting to prevent melting and ensure a perfect presentation.

Flavor Boost: For an extra coffee kick, consider adding a splash of espresso instead of the instant coffee to enhance the pumpkin spice flavor.

Pumpkin Spice Latte Cupcakes to Savor This Fall Season

Delight in the warmth of Pumpkin Spice Latte Cupcakes, perfect for fall gatherings.
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Cooling Time 15 minutes
Total Time 55 minutes
Servings: 12 cupcakes
Course: DESSERTS
Cuisine: American
Calories: 350

Ingredients
  

For the Cupcakes
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our provides the perfect structure for your cupcakes.
  • 1.5 cups granulated sugar adds the sweetness that balances the spices beautifully.
  • 2 teaspoons baking powder ensures your cupcakes rise to fluffy perfection.
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da gives an extra lift to your delightful treats.
  • 0.5 teaspoon salt enhances the overall flavor, making it more pronounced.
  • 1.5 teaspoons ground cinnamon the quintessential spice that brings warmth and nostalgia.
  • 1 teaspoon pumpkin pie spice infuses those classic autumn flavors into every bite.
  • 3 large eggs binds everything together while keeping the cupcakes moist.
  • 15 oz canned pumpkin puree the star ingredient that delivers that rich, pumpkin flavor.
  • 0.25 cups coffee adds a subtle depth, echoing the beloved pumpkin spice latte.
  • 1 tablespoon instant coffee intensifies the coffee flavor without the fuss.
  • 0.25 cups half and half or full-fat milk/cream ensures a tender crumb and richness.
  • 0.5 cups vegetable oil keeps your cupcakes moist and deliciously tender.
For the Frosting
  • 6 oz cream cheese the creamy base that lends a tangy sweetness to your frosting.
  • 9 tablespoons butter gives the frosting a rich texture that’s hard to resist.
  • 0.5 cups shortening helps stabilize the frosting for beautiful décor.
  • 1.5 teaspoons pumpkin pie spice carries the seasonal flavor through to the frosting as well.
  • 2.5 cups powdered confectioners’ sugar sweetens and thickens the frosting to perfection.
For the Decoration
  • Gingersnap cookies a crunchy, spiced topping that complements the cupcake’s flavor.
  • Green straws add a whimsical touch for presentation at gatherings.
  • Caramel sauce drizzled on top for an extra indulgent finish.

Equipment

  • Muffin tin
  • Mixing bowls
  • whisk
  • Electric Mixer

Method
 

Cupcake Preparation
  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Prepare cupcake liners in a muffin tin for easy serving.
  2. Whisk together the all-purpose fl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t, ground cinnamon, and pumpkin pie spice in a large bowl.
  3. Combine the wet ingredients: whisk the eggs, pumpkin puree, coffee, instant coffee, half and half, and vegetable oil until smooth.
  4. Mix the dry ingredients into the wet mixture gradually. Stir until just combined.
  5. Pour the batter evenly into prepared cupcake liners, filling each about two-thirds full.
  6. Bake for 18-20 minutes, or until a toothpick comes out clean.
  7. Prepare the frosting while the cupcakes cool by beating together the cream cheese, butter, shortening, pumpkin pie spice, and powdered sugar until smooth.
  8. Cool the cupcakes completely before frosting them.
  9. Decorate with crushed gingersnap cookies, green straws, and caramel sauce.
